    Draw of Sport HC (2017 Fantagraphics) By Murray Olderman 1-1ST

    1st printing. Sports cartoonist/journalist Murray Olderman began his career in 1947 when many metropolitan newspapers had their own full-time cartoonists to decorate their sports sections. Olderman met most of the greatest sports personalities of the 20th century, from Jesse Owens and Babe Ruth to Tiger Woods and Kobe Bryant. The Draw of Sport compiles over 150 of Olderman's favorite personalities from the sporting world. Each full-page illustration is accompanied by Olderman's own personal reminiscences of those illustrious stars. Hardcover, 7-in. x 9-in., 200 pages, B&W. Cover price $24.99.

    Drawn to Purpose: American Women Illustrators and Cartoonists HC (2018 UPoM) 1-1ST

    1st printing. Written by Martha Kennedy. Published in partnership with the Library of Congress, Drawn to Purpose: American Women Illustrators and Cartoonists presents an overarching survey of women in American illustration, from the late nineteenth into the twenty-first century. Martha H. Kennedy brings special attention to forms that have heretofore received scant notice-cover designs, editorial illustrations, and political cartoons-and reveals the contributions of acclaimed cartoonists and illustrators, along with many whose work has been overlooked. Hardcover, 8-in. x 11-in., 256 pages, full color. Cover price $50.00.

    Dungeons and Dragons Lore and Legends HC (2023 Ten Speed Press) 1-1ST


    (see more images)

    A Visual Celebration of the Fifth Edition of the World's Greatest Roleplaying Game!

    1st printing. Written by Michael Witwer, Kyle Newman, Jon Peterson, and Sam Witwer. Foreword by Tom Morello. When the reimagined fifth edition of DUNGEONS & DRAGONS debuted in the summer of 2014, tabletop roleplaying games were on the brink of obsolescence. But within a few short years, D&D found greater success than it had ever enjoyed before, even surpassing its 1980s golden age. How did an analog game nearly a half century old become a star in a digital world? For the first time, LORE & LEGENDS reveals the incredible ongoing story of DUNGEONS & DRAGONS fifth edition from the perspective of the designers, artists, and players who bring it to life. This comprehensive visual guide illuminates contemporary D&D-its development, evolution, cultural relevance, and popularity-through exclusive interviews and more than 900 pieces of artwork, photography, and advertising. Hardcover, 9-in. x 12-in., 416 pages, full color. Cover price $50.00.

    Everett Raymond Kinstler: The Artist's Journey Through Popular Culture 1942-1962 HC (2005 Underwood Books) 1-1ST

    1st printing. By Jim Vadeboncoeur Jr. and Everett Raymond Kinstler. Everette Raymond Kinstler's portraits of Ronald Reagan, John Wayne, Jimmy Cagney, and Katharine Hepburn are familiar to art lovers, but few realize that Kinstler illustrated pulps and comics. Included herein is an extended biography and more than 300 illustrations - many reproduced from originals, including double-page pulp spreads, paperback novel covers, and panels from Classic Illustrated. Hardcover, 8 1/2-in. x 11-in., 240 pages, PC/PB&W. Cover price $44.95.
